New findings on the prototypical Of?p stars.

NAZE Y., UD-DOULA A., SPANO M., RAUW G., DE BECKER M. and WALBORN N.R.

Abstract (from CDS):

In recent years several in-depth investigations of the three prototypical Of?p stars were undertaken. These multiwavelength studies revealed the peculiar properties of these objects (in the X-rays as well as in the optical): magnetic fields, periodic line profile variations, recurrent photometric changes. However, many questions remain unsolved. To clarify some of the properties of the Of?p stars, we have continued their monitoring. A new xmm-Newton observation and two new optical datasets were obtained. Additional information about the prototypical Of?p trio has been found. HD108 has now reached its quiescent, minimum-emission state for the first time in 50-60yr. The echelle spectra of HD148937 confirm the presence of the 7d variations in the Balmer lines and reveal similar periodic variations (though of lower amplitudes) in the HeIλ5876 and HeIIλ4686 lines, underlining its similarities with the other two prototypical Of?p stars. The new xmm-Newton observation of HD191612 was taken at the same phase in the line modulation cycle, but at a different orbital phase from previous data. It clearly shows that the X-ray emission of HD191612 is modulated by the 538d period and not by the orbital period of 1542d - it is thus not of colliding-wind origin. The phenomenon responsible for the optical changes appears also at work in the high-energy domain. There are problems however: our MHD simulations of the wind magnetic confinement predict both a harder X-ray flux of a much larger strength than what is observed (the modelled differential emission measure peaks at 30-40MK, whereas the observed one peaks at 2MK) and narrow lines (hot gas moving with velocities of 100-200km/s whereas the observed full width at half maximum is ∼2000km/s).
